The Uplifting Power of Love in Chicago's Anthem

“(Your Love Keeps Lifting Me) Higher And Higher” by Chicago is a jubilant celebration of the transformative power of love. The lyrics convey a sense of elevation and joy that comes from being in a loving relationship. The repeated refrain, “Your love keeps lifting me higher and higher,” emphasizes the continuous and ever-increasing impact of love on the narrator’s life. This love is not static; it is dynamic and constantly propelling the narrator to new emotional heights.

The song also touches on themes of overcoming past hardships. The narrator reflects on a time when they were “downhearted” and disappointment was their “closest friend.” However, the arrival of their partner marked a turning point, banishing those negative feelings and replacing them with a sense of hope and upliftment. This shift underscores the idea that love has the power to heal and transform, making it a potent force in the narrator’s life.

Musically, the song’s upbeat tempo and energetic instrumentation mirror the uplifting message of the lyrics. The instrumental interlude provides a moment of pure musical joy, reinforcing the theme of elevation. The song’s structure, with its repetitive and escalating chorus, mimics the feeling of being lifted higher and higher, creating an immersive experience for the listener. Overall, the song is a testament to the positive and life-affirming power of love, capturing the essence of emotional and spiritual elevation through its vibrant melody and heartfelt lyrics.
